Indlela yokwakha
1. Ukwakha, ukucindezela komshini, ukusakaza
Ukwakha: okwaziwa kakhulu ngokuthi “ukwenza insimbi”.
Ukucindezela komshini: ukunyathela, ukuphotha, ukukhipha
Ukunyathela: Sebenzisa imishini yokucindezela kanye nezikhunta ezifanele ukukhiqiza inqubo yomkhiqizo edingekayo. Ihlukaniswe ngezinqubo eziningana ezifana nokusika, ukuvala, ukwakha, ukwelula, kanye nokukhanyisa.
Imishini yokukhiqiza eyinhloko: umshini wokugunda, umshini wokugoba, umshini wokubhoboza, umshini wokunyathelisa we-hydraulic, njll.
Ukuphotha: Ngokusebenzisa ukunwebeka kwezinto, umshini wokuphotha ufakwe isikhunta esihambisanayo kanye nokusekelwa kobuchwepheshe kwabasebenzi ukuze kufezwe inqubo yokukhanya komgwaqo kwe-LED. Kusetshenziswa kakhulu ezibukisini zokuphotha kanye nezinkomishi zezibani.
Imishini yokukhiqiza eyinhloko: umshini onqenqemeni oluyindilinga, umshini wokuphotha, umshini wokusika, njll.
Ukwelulwa: Ngokusebenzisa ukunwetshwa kwezinto, ngokusebenzisa i-extruder futhi ifakwe isikhunta esimile, icindezelwa enkambisweni yokukhanya komgwaqo kwe-LED esikudingayo. Le nqubo isetshenziswa kabanzi ekwenziweni kwamaphrofayili e-aluminium, amapayipi ensimbi, kanye nokufakwa kwamapayipi epulasitiki.
Imishini eyinhloko: i-extruder.
Ukukhipha: ukuphonsa ngesihlabathi, ukuphonsa ngokunemba (isikhunta se-wax esilahlekile), ukuphonsa ngodayi Ukuphonsa ngesihlabathi: inqubo yokusebenzisa isihlabathi ukwenza umgodi wokuthulula ukuze kutholakale ukuphonsa.
Ukuphonswa okunembile: sebenzisa i-wax ukwenza isikhunta esifana nomkhiqizo; faka upende ngokuphindaphindiwe bese ufafaza isihlabathi kusikhunta; bese uncibilikisa isikhunta sangaphakathi ukuze uthole umgodi; bhaka igobolondo bese uthela izinto zensimbi ezidingekayo; susa isihlabathi ngemva kokusikhipha ukuze uthole umkhiqizo oqediwe onemba kakhulu.
Ukuphonswa nge-die: indlela yokuphonswa lapho uketshezi lwe-alloy oluncibilikisiwe lufakwa khona ekamelweni lokucindezela ukuze kugcwaliswe umgodi wesikhunta sensimbi ngesivinini esikhulu, bese uketshezi lwe-alloy luqina ngaphansi kwengcindezi ukuze kwakheke ukuphonswa nge-die. Ukuphonswa nge-die kuhlukaniswe ngokuthi ukuphonswa nge-die chamber eshisayo kanye nokuphonswa nge-die chamber ebandayo.
Ukuphonswa kwe-die chamber eshisayo: izinga eliphezulu lokuzenzakalela, ukusebenza kahle okuphezulu, ukumelana nokushisa okuphezulu komkhiqizo, isikhathi esifushane sokupholisa, esisetshenziselwa ukuphonswa kwe-zinc alloy die.
Ukuphonswa kwedayi yegumbi elibandayo: Kunezinqubo eziningi zokusebenza ngesandla, ukusebenza kahle okuphansi, ukumelana okuhle nokushisa okuphezulu komkhiqizo, isikhathi eside sokupholisa, futhi isetshenziselwa ukuphonswa kwedayi ye-aluminium alloy. Imishini yokukhiqiza: umshini wokuphonswa kwedayi.
2. Ukucutshungulwa kwemishini
Inqubo yokukhiqiza lapho izingxenye zomkhiqizo zicutshungulwa ngqo ngezinto zokwakha.
Imishini eyinhloko yokukhiqiza ifaka phakathi ama-lathe, imishini yokugaya, imishini yokubhoboza, ama-lathe okulawula izinombolo (NC), izikhungo zomshini (CNC), njll.
3. Ukubumba ngomjovo
Le nqubo yokukhiqiza ifana nokuphonswa nge-die, inqubo yokubumba kanye nokushisa kokucubungula kuphela okuhlukile. Izinto ezisetshenziswa kakhulu yilezi: i-ABS, i-PBT, i-PC kanye nezinye ipulasitiki. Imishini yokukhiqiza: umshini wokubumba ngomjovo.
4. Ukukhipha
Kubizwa nangokuthi ukubumba kwe-extrusion noma i-extrusion ekucutshungulweni kwepulasitiki, kanye ne-extrusion ekucutshungulweni kwerabha. Kubhekisela endleleni yokucubungula lapho izinto zidlula khona esenzweni esiphakathi komgqomo we-extruder kanye nesikulufu, kuyilapho zifudunyezwa futhi zenziwe ipulasitiki, bese zisunduzwa phambili yi-screw, futhi ziqhutshwe njalo ngekhanda le-die ukuze kwenziwe imikhiqizo ehlukahlukene yesigaba noma imikhiqizo eqediwe kancane.
Imishini yokukhiqiza: i-extruder.
Izindlela zokwelapha ubuso
Ukwelashwa kobuso bemikhiqizo yokukhanya komgwaqo we-LED kuhlanganisa kakhulu ukupholisha, ukufutha kanye nokufaka i-electroplating.
1. Ukupholisha:
Indlela yenqubo yokubumba ubuso bomsebenzi kusetshenziswa isondo lokugaya eliqhutshwa yinjini, isondo le-hemp, noma isondo lendwangu. Isetshenziswa kakhulu ukupholisha ubuso bezinto ezidayiwe, izitembu, kanye nezingxenye ezijikelezayo, futhi ngokuvamile isetshenziswa njengenqubo yangaphambili yokufaka i-electroplating. Ingasetshenziswa futhi njengokwelashwa komphumela wobuso bezinto (njenge-sunflowers).
2. Ukufutha:
A. Isimiso/Izinzuzo:
Lapho kusebenza, isibhamu sokufafaza noma ipuleti lokufafaza kanye nendebe yokufafaza yokufafaza nge-electrostatic kuxhunywe ku-electrode engemihle, bese umsebenzi uxhunywe ku-electrode engemihle bese ubekwa phansi. Ngaphansi kwe-voltage ephezulu yejeneretha ye-electrostatic enamandla aphezulu, kwakheka insimu ye-electrostatic phakathi kokuphela kwesibhamu sokufafaza (noma ipuleti lokufafaza, indebe yokufafaza) kanye nomsebenzi. Uma i-voltage iphezulu ngokwanele, kwakheka indawo ye-ionization yomoya endaweni eseduze nokuphela kwesibhamu sokufafaza. Iningi lama-resin kanye nemibala ependeni yakhiwe ngamakhemikhali e-organic anama-molecule amaningi, ikakhulukazi ayi-dielectrics eqhubayo. Upende ufafazwa ngemuva koku-atomized yi-nozzle, kanti izinhlayiya zopende ezi-atomized ziyashajwa ngenxa yokuxhumana lapho zidlula enalitini yesigxobo sesibhamu noma emaphethelweni epuleti lokufafaza noma indebe yokufafaza. Ngaphansi kwesenzo sensimu ye-electrostatic, lezi zinhlayiya zopende ezishaja kabi ziya ngase-polarity engemihle yendawo yokusebenza futhi zifakwa endaweni yokusebenza ukuze zakhe ungqimba olufanayo.
B. Inqubo
(1) Ukwelashwa kwangaphambili kwendawo: ukususa amafutha kanye nokususa ukugqwala ukuze kuhlanzwe indawo yokusebenza.
(2) Ukwelashwa kwefilimu engaphezulu: Ukwelashwa kwefilimu ye-phosphate kuyindlela yokugqwala egcina izingxenye ezigqwalayo ebusweni bensimbi futhi isebenzisa indlela ehlakaniphile yokusebenzisa imikhiqizo yokugqwala ukwakha ifilimu.
(3) Ukomisa: Susa umswakama emsebenzini olungisiwe.
(4) Ukufutha. Ngaphansi kwensimu ye-electrostatic enamandla aphezulu, isibhamu sokufutha esiyimpuphu sixhunywe epalini elingemihle bese i-workpiece ibekwa phansi (ipali elihle) ukuze kwakheke isekethe. Impuphu ifuthwa iphume epalini lokufutha ngosizo lomoya ocindezelwe futhi ishajwe kabi. Ifuthwa epanini lokusebenza ngokwesimiso sokudonselana okuphambene.
(5) Ukwelapha. Ngemva kokufutha, umsebenzi uthunyelwa ekamelweni lokomisa ku-180-200℃ ukuze kufudunyezwe ukuze kuqiniswe impuphu.
(6) Ukuhlolwa. Hlola ukwakheka kwento yokusebenza. Uma kukhona amaphutha njengokufutha okungekho, imihuzuko, amabhamuza ephini, njll., kufanele aphinde alungiswe futhi afuthwe kabusha.
C. Isicelo:
Ukufana, ukucwebezela kanye nokunamathela kwengqimba yopende ebusweni bento yokusebenza efuthwa ngokufutha ngogesi kungcono kunaleyo yokufutha okuvamile okwenziwa ngesandla. Ngesikhathi esifanayo, ukufutha ngogesi kungafutha ngopende ojwayelekile wokufutha, upende oxubene ngamafutha nowe-magnetic, upende we-perchlorethylene, upende we-amino resin, upende we-epoxy resin, njll. Kulula ukuyisebenzisa futhi kungonga cishe u-50% wopende uma kuqhathaniswa nokufutha komoya ojwayelekile.
3. Ukufaka i-electroplate:
Kuyinqubo yokufaka ungqimba oluncane lwezinye izinsimbi noma ama-alloy ezindaweni ezithile zensimbi kusetshenziswa isimiso se-electrolysis. Ama-cation ensimbi efakwe ngogesi ancishiswa ebusweni bensimbi ukuze kwakheke uqweqwe. Ukuze kukhishwe amanye ama-cation ngesikhathi sokufaka uqweqwe, insimbi yokufaka uqweqwe isebenza njenge-anode futhi i-oxidized ibe ama-cation bese ingena kwisisombululo se-electroplating; umkhiqizo wensimbi ozofakwa uqweqwe usebenza njenge-cathode ukuvimbela ukuphazamiseka kwegolide yokufaka uqweqwe, nokwenza i-plating ifane futhi iqine, isixazululo esiqukethe ama-cation ensimbi yokufaka uqweqwe siyadingeka njengesixazululo se-electroplating ukugcina ukuhlushwa kwama-cation ensimbi yokufaka kungashintshi. Inhloso yokufaka uqweqwe ukugcwalisa uqweqwe lwensimbi ku-substrate ukushintsha izakhiwo noma usayizi wobuso be-substrate. I-Electroplating ingathuthukisa ukumelana nokugqwala kwensimbi, yandise ubulukhuni, ivimbele ukuguguleka, ithuthukise ukuhamba komoya, ukuthambisa, ukumelana nokushisa, kanye nobuhle bobuso. I-Aluminium surface anodizing: Inqubo yokubeka i-aluminium njenge-anode kusisombululo se-electrolyte nokusebenzisa i-electrolysis ukwakha i-aluminium oxide ebusweni bayo ibizwa ngokuthi i-aluminium anodizing.
